The Core Difference: It's More Than Just "Adding a Phone Number"

On the surface, a PVA account is just one linked to an overseas phone number. However, its essence is a "trust credential" within the platform's risk control system. This trust disparity manifests in several key dimensions:

  • Account Weight & Initial Traffic Pool: Regular accounts, especially bulk-registered ones, are seen as high-risk by TikTok's algorithm. New content often gets restricted to an extremely small initial traffic pool (often under 200 views), effectively meaning "posted and forgotten." A compliant TikTok account, especially a PVA verified by a real person, starts with significantly higher weight and a much better chance of receiving normal initial distribution.
  • Risk Control Threshold & Lifespan: This is the most critical difference. Regular accounts have a very low tolerance for activities like "logging in from a different location," "frequently switching networks," or "sensitive actions" (like bulk following or liking). I once worked with a studio that bought batch regular accounts; after just three days of inactivity post-setup, over 40% were reclaimed for "suspected fake accounts." PVA accounts, due to their "real user" characteristic, have a higher tolerance for standard operations and a theoretically longer lifespan.
  • Operational Costs & "Hidden Expenses": The higher unit cost of a PVA account is the "visible expense." The "hidden cost" of regular accounts lies in their extremely high attrition rate and low operational efficiency. You end up paying for many "dead accounts" and waste significant time constantly replacing and nurturing accounts, severely squeezing time for actual business activities like live streaming or e-commerce.

Three Hidden Traps When Choosing an Account: Pitfalls Many Beginners Face

Knowing the differences isn't enough; you must also beware of traps in the selection process. Industry feedback consistently highlights these three common pitfalls:

  1. "Fake PVA" & "One-Time Verification": Some unscrupulous providers offer so-called "PVA accounts" that use virtual numbers from temporary SMS receive online platforms or already-defunct numbers. Once the platform initiates a secondary verification or risk check, these accounts are immediately exposed, with a high risk of being banned. A real case involved a user who bought a batch of "PVA accounts" for live streaming; within minutes of going live, all accounts went offline. Investigation revealed the bound phone numbers could no longer receive verification codes.
  2. Accounts with "Congenital Weight Deficiency": Not all PVA accounts are effective. If an account was dormant for a long time after registration or has a history of violations, its "internal damage" is hard to fix, even if a phone number is currently linked. Buying such an account might still lead to poor traffic performance, far from the "high weight" you expect.
  3. After-Sales Service & "Seller Disappearing" Risk: Account trading isn't a one-and-done transaction. Accounts can later run into problems due to subsequent platform risk control or malicious recovery by the seller. A provider lacking stable after-sales support and a clear ownership transfer agreement will leave you with no recourse when issues arise.
